Output 66908f73097c5830c6163433cc565c98b714f451edc122e89180b07a80a9001e:61

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69721909e84dc50584ebe516eb3c1d0fc2bffea7d0543ef286ce9f65aa1fa06d
address
bc1pd9epjz0gfhzstp8tu5twk0qaplptll486p2rau5xe60kt2sl5pkstm3xyk
transaction
66908f73097c5830c6163433cc565c98b714f451edc122e89180b07a80a9001e
spent
true